TAMILIA, Judge:

Appellant, Harry M. Stevens, Inc. (Stevens), appeals from an Order of judgment entered against him, contending the trial court erred in instructing the jury as to the application of the Comparative Negligence Act (Comparative Act), 42 Pa.C.S.A. § 7102 et seq.
